On Wednesday 06 Jul 2011 7:42:46 PM Tony Garnock-Jones wrote:
> I haven't been able to use the Linux VM's full-screen support for years.
> Instead I have had to configure my window manager (Sawfish) to recognise
> Squeak windows by X class, and to draw them without any window
> decorations. Once Squeak is open, I press my "maximise window" shortcut
> key which makes it roughly full-screen. Definitely a poor-man's solution.
Both Squeak and Etoys have worked in fullscreen mode flawlessly for me on Linux
(currently on Kubuntu 10.10, intel graphics driver). I use World Menu-
>appearance->full screen on/off.
